§1194.21(k) of Section 508 addresses the adverse impact that flashing or blinking text (or other elements) may have on people with photosensitive epilepsy. Read the question below and select the response that is most accurate. You will receive immediate feedback.

What frequency rate can trigger a seizure in people with photosensitive epilepsy?

  1. Greater than 2 Hz and lower than 55 Hz.
  2. Between 60 Hz and 75 Hz.
  3. Greater than 75 Hz and lower than 120 Hz.
  4. None (frequency rate of a blinking or flashing item cannot trigger a seizure).
